Title: Steve S. Chung: An Innovator in Tunneling Field Effect Transistors

Introduction

Steve S. Chung, based in Hsinchu, Taiwan, is a notable inventor with a prolific portfolio of 20 patents. His groundbreaking work focuses on advancements in semiconductor technology, specifically in the development of tunneling field effect transistors, which have significant implications for modern electronics.

Latest Patents

One of Chung's latest inventions is a staggered-type tunneling field effect transistor. This patent describes a transistor design characterized by an overlapping structure between the source and drain regions, thereby enhancing the tunneling area. The design includes a doped region within a semi-conductive substrate, while the opposite region is formed through epitaxial deposition over the doped area. The gate is strategically placed over the epitaxial region where both the doped and epitaxial areas intersect. Additionally, the doped region may be structured in a fin formation, with the gate and epitaxial region situated on the top and sides of the fin, paving the way for improved device performance and efficiency.

Career Highlights

Steve Chung has made significant contributions to the field while working at esteemed organizations such as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Ltd. and National Chiao Tung University. His work in these institutions has established him as a leader in semiconductor research and development.

Collaborations

In addition to his individual accomplishments, Chung has collaborated with several notable colleagues, including Ching-Hsiang Hsu and Mong-Song Liang. Their joint efforts have further propelled innovations in tunneling field effect transistors and semiconductor technology.
